The Complete, Authoritative Guide to Getting Started in Tax Consulting Tax consulting and return preparation is a fast-paced, dynamic industry-one that promises high earning potential. In this book, tax advisor Gary Carter shows you just what it takes to become an in-demand tax consultant. You'll discover how to break into the tax business, even with relatively limited education and training, and build a path to your new career with Carter's five-step formula for success. Brimming with expert advice from tax professionals and featuring up-to-the-minute coverage of everything from qualifications and employment opportunities to Internet resources, Getting Started in Tax Consulting shows you how to:
- Assess your personality fit for the tax profession
- Formulate your business plan for starting a tax practice
- Find a niche for your tax services
- Choose between a sole proprietorship, a partnership, a C corporation, an S corporation, and a limited liability company
- Set your fees and market your services
- Perform research-an essential skill of the tax professional
- Make the IRS your partner and advisor-not your adversary
- Start a Web-based tax service
